Tasting Notes

Robert Parker 98

Tasted at “The Sampler” icon tasting in London. I have tasted few vintages of the rare Cuvee Cathelin and this 1991 makes me rue the fact that I am not a millionaire! The 1991 just has a beautiful, melted bouquet with subtle gamey notes emerging: garrigues, white fennel, thyme and a hint of vanilla emanating from the oak. It is very focused and refined ” much more captivating than I remember the 1990 many years ago. The palate is medium-bodied with hung meat, sage, white pepper and fennel on the entry. The tannins are a little chalky, but it is very well balanced and full of personality, generosity and refinement. This is just a beautiful Hermitage. Tasted December 2012. [Neal Martin, 12/01/2012]

Vinous 97

I was blown away by Chave’s 1991 Cuvée Cathelin. Still incredibly fresh, this vibrant, opulent wine revealed extraordinary precision and nuance in a full-bodied style. Dark cherries, cassis, earthiness, smoke and graphite all made an appearance in this breathtakingly pure, expressive wine. [Antonio Galloni, 01/08/2007]
